Navya Naveli Nanda paints a wall in a Mumbai area on the occasion of World Menstrual Hygiene Day

bollywood megastar Amitabh BachchanGranddaughter Navya Naveli Nanda celebrated World Menstrual Hygiene Day on Saturday by painting a wall in Ghatkopar East in Mumbai.

Sharing a video on her Instagram handle painting the wall, Navya Naveli wrote: “Just here we are drawing a wall mural on periods to celebrate World Menstrual Hygiene Day. It is our endeavor to make the locations more duration friendly.”

Sharing the picture, she captioned it: “Happy World Menstrual Hygiene Day!” Following his post, his mother Shweta Bachchan wrote enthusiastically: “Navya. Love you and proud baby.”

Her sentiments were shared by many netizens, who praised Navya Naveli for spreading the positive message.
